In terms of narrative it makes too much sense to have first girl win. She's the one who opens new doors for the protagonist, the one who typically goes through the most trials with him, the one who has all that emphasis at the outset of the story. Structurally it just makes sense. This is fine in plain romance shows, because duh, but it's why harems are so often boring, there's zero tension because you're familiar with narrative structure. So you either change the structure a little, like BokuBen having two first girls, or you pull something off in the story itself where it makes sense for MC to choose someone else like .

TWGOK was a good example, the "first girl" never exhibited interest and had zero romantic chemistry with MC from the beginning, and the entire premise was going through girls like toilet paper, so in the end when he chose one there was some tension, even if it was a little obvious for those who were paying attention.

Manga, LNs and WNs usually have indefinite length. Series starts with a premise, some basic concept, a draft of the general plot and then author continues to shit out chapters for as long as he can. And of course, the draft of the plot will most likely include the winner of the MCbowl. So unless the author has some grand design in mind and purposefully delays the introduction of the winner or lets his story live its own life, girls other than the first ones introduced are just filler characters shoved in to generate more content.
For example - Nisekoi. The one shot included only Chitoge and it was obvious that she was the only girl Komi had in mind when coming up with the idea for the story. Then he added a distraction, namely Onodera and the pendant, that was supposed to act as a speed bump for the actual romance. Just a love triangle wasn't enough, so he started to introduce girls one after another to bloat the chapter count.

The other thing is that this industry is fond of safe developments. The first girl winning is boring and predictable, but also inoffensive and easy to promote.
